Unlocking Mental Clarity: Simple Strategies for a Clear Mind and Focused Life

In our fast-paced world, where distractions are abundant and information overload is the norm, achieving mental clarity has never been more crucial. Mental clarity allows us to think more clearly, make better decisions, and reduce anxiety and stress. This blog post explores the multifaceted concept of mental clarity, its importance, techniques to enhance it, and its profound impact on our daily lives.

The Importance of Mental Clarity

Mental clarity refers to the ability to think clearly and focus effectively. It is essential not only for academic and professional success but also for personal well-being. Here are several reasons why mental clarity is important:

  • Improved Decision Making: Better clarity leads to more informed and timely decisions.
  • Enhanced Creativity: With a clear mind, creative solutions and ideas can flow freely.
  • Stress Reduction: A cluttered mind can cause anxiety; clarity promotes a sense of calm.
  • Increased Productivity: Clear thoughts lead to effective planning and execution of tasks.

Factors Affecting Mental Clarity

Physical Health

Your physical well-being significantly impacts your mental state. Key factors include:

  • Nutrition: A balanced diet rich in omega-3 fatty acids, antioxidants, and vitamins is essential for optimal brain function.
  • Exercise: Regular physical activity increases blood flow to the brain and supports mental sharpness.
  • Sleep: Quality sleep is critical for memory consolidation and cognitive function.

Emotional Well-Being

Your emotional state can cloud your thinking. Here are some emotional factors to consider:

  • Stress Levels: Chronic stress can lead to mental fog and confusion.
  • Mindfulness: Practicing mindfulness can help maintain emotional balance and clarity.
  • Social Interaction: Positive relationships can enhance mental clarity and reduce feelings of isolation.

Techniques to Enhance Mental Clarity

Mindfulness and Meditation

Mindfulness practices are beneficial in achieving and sustaining mental clarity. Consider the following tips:

  1. Daily Meditation: Set aside 10-15 minutes each day to meditate, focusing on your breath and letting go of distractions.
  2. Mindful Breathing: Practice deep breathing exercises throughout the day to reset your mind.
  3. Body Scanning: This involves paying attention to different parts of your body to become more aware and grounded.

Decluttering Your Environment

A cluttered workspace can impede your ability to think clearly. Follow these steps to declutter:

  • Tidy Up: Keep your workspace clean and organized.
  • Minimize Distractions: Identify distractions and remove them; this includes notifications from devices.
  • Create a Dedicated Space: Establish a specific area for focused work, free from interruptions.

Common Misconceptions about Mental Clarity

Myth: Mental Clarity is Only for Certain People

Many believe mental clarity is an inherent trait rather than a skill that can be developed. In truth, anyone can cultivate mental clarity through deliberate practice and techniques.

Myth: Clarity Comes Naturally

While moments of clarity can occur spontaneously, maintaining it requires conscious effort and practice. Incorporating the techniques listed above into your daily routine can foster a clearer mindset over time.

Measuring Mental Clarity

Understanding the effectiveness of mental clarity techniques can be subjective; however, assessing your progress is beneficial. Consider using these methods:

  • Journaling: Keep a daily journal to reflect on your thoughts and track changes in clarity over time.
  • Mood Tracking: Use a mood tracker app to assess changes in your emotional state correlated with your mental clarity.
  • Self-Assessment: Regularly ask yourself how clear your thoughts are and adjust your strategies based on your observations.
